Recently, McLeod Health Cheraw, McLeod Health Clarendon, and McLeod Health Dillon were recognized for their commitment to patient safety with an “A” Hospital Safety Grade from the Leapfrog Group. This national nonprofit organization focuses on maintaining high standards of patient safety in hospitals and ambulatory surgery centers.
Dr. Caetie Rabon, Rural Regional Chief Medical Officer for McLeod Health, expressed gratitude for the recognition and attributed it to the hard work and dedication of the hospital teams. The Leapfrog Group evaluates hospitals based on over 30 measures of errors, accidents, injuries, infections, and preventive systems in place.
McLeod Health Cheraw has received the “A” Hospital Safety Grade from Leapfrog four times in a row.
